What happened to UFO hunter and world-renowned British conspiracy theorist Maxwell Bates Spiers? Handsome, high energy and full of wacky theories, Max was and in-demand speaker and panelist all over the world on subjects as diverse as UFOs, the paranormal and political conspiracy theories. So when he died suddenly in Poland in 2016 at a friend’s home, the conspiracy theories turned inwards, fuelled by poor police work from the Polish authorities and a mysterious text from Max to his mother. In 1971, Dan Cooper paid 20 bucks at Portland airport for a flight to Seattle and boarded a Northwest Orient flight wearing a dark suit, a tie with a tie clip and an attache case. He ordered some booze, lit up a cig and then handed one of the flight attendants a note saying he wanted 200,000 US dollars, 4 parachutes and that he had a bomb in his bag. What ensued was quiet chaos. Dan jumped out of the plane, clutching the money, and was never seen again. So what happened to DB Cooper? Who the hell is Dan Cooper? And where's the money? Cardiac Cowboys
The heart was always off-limits to surgeons. Cutting into it spelled instant death for the patient. That is, until a ragtag group of doctors scattered across the Midwest and Texas decided to throw out the rule book. Working in makeshift laboratories and home garages, using medical devices made from scavenged machine parts and beer tubes, these men and women invented the field of open heart surgery. Odds are, someone you know is alive because of them. So why has history left them behind? Presented by Chris Pine, CARDIAC COWBOYS tells the gripping true story behind the birth of heart surgery, and the young, Greatest Generation doctors who made it happen. For years, they competed and feuded, racing to be the first, the best, and the most prolific. Some appeared on the cover of Time Magazine, operated on kings and advised presidents. Others ended up disgraced, penniless, and convicted of felonies. Together, they ignited a revolution in medicine, and changed the world.
